Population

      Islam has affected Guinea because it makes up the majority of their population. Guinea’s population is approximately 12 million (worldpopulationreview.com). Its population is 85% Muslim, 8% Christian, and 7% indigenous beliefs (Nationmaster.com). Its ethnic groups are 40% Peuhl, 30% Malinke, 20% Soussou, and 10% smaller ethnic groups (nationmaster.com).  Although the main language of Guinea is French, many people also speak Malinké (Maninkakan), Fulani (Poular), Soussou, Kpelle (Guerzé), Loma (Toma), Kissi, Coniagui, and Bassari. The ratio of genders is 1 male per female. The birth rate is 36.3 births per 1,000 people. The death rate is 9.94 deaths per 1,000 people (nationmaster.com). The majority of people in Guinea honor the Islamic religion as represented by these statistics.
